Codification

The systematic enactment of legal rules in an organized code, aiming to make law coherent, accessible, and authoritative.

Codification organizes legal rules into a structured legislative text, often replacing scattered statutes, customs, or judge-made doctrines. It is central to civil-law systems, where codes guide interpretation and legal education, though courts and scholarship still shape meaning. Swiss private law is strongly codified, while federalism and specialized legislation add layers outside the major codes. Comparatively, codification contrasts with common-law reliance on precedent but never eliminates interpretation, gaps, or the need to adapt legal concepts to social and technological change.
